The Oxygen Sensor is an important attribute of the emission control in vehicles, used to maintain the Challenger engines high performance levels while at the same time ensuring clean emissions. This semiconductor reduces the amount of hydrogen in the merging exhaust gases and thus communicates to the ECU the amount of oxygen in the exhaust and enables the ECU to correct the A/F ratio. This dynamic adjustment is relevant as both rich and lean mixtures are harmful to the engine performance, as well as its life cycle. Oxygen sensors that have been incorporated in Dodge Challenger models comprise of zirconia and titania sensors. There are zirconia sensors which are manufactured in both narrow band and wide band, and they are particularly useful in the control of fuel mixtures. On the other hand, titania sensors work as they modify resistance as opposed to the generation of voltage. Anyhow, the Oxygen Sensor when malfunctioning leads to high emissions and fuel consumption thus needs replacement for the optimal performance of the vehicle.
